NEW MUSIC: Cage the Elephant perform ‘Rubber Ball’ with a choir & acoustic setup

Today Cage the Elephant shared this performance of ‘Rubber Ball’ from their upcoming new LP ‘Unpleeled’ which sees the band do different versions of previously released tracks in a live setting with acoustic versions. These were recorded on the band’s ‘Live & Unpeeled’ tour across the U.S. The band with Kentucky origins, is known for wild loud raucous shows which we’ve seen in person on the Nights We Stole Christmas and Lollapalooza, so see them softer and more intimate is a solid shift yet one they appear to be doing gracefully as ever. The album due out on this Friday is 21 tracks of reworkings of previous songs with covers of  The Stranglers’ “Golden Brown” and Daft Punk’s “Instant Crush”.

Here is another track off ‘Unpeeled’ called ‘Whole Wide World’ which is cover of Brittish new wave artist Wreckless Eric
